Half-Step Laws

12 Wednesday Apr 2023

Posted by Commentary about the Blue Marble in Gun Control

≈ Leave a comment

        I keep hearing the so called law-abiding constitutionalists that say we have enough gun laws on the books. We only need to enforce them to cut crime. Illinois is a prime example of how those laws are skirted. Illinois has fairly strict ownership laws but there are many ways to get around them. The gun dealers want to make money from sales so they sell assault weapons to anyone with money no matter what tattoos or badges they show. Extended magazines have only one real reason to exist and it is to kill lots of people.

            The easiest way around Illinois Laws is to cross the Indiana border and buy guns from a gun show. No waiting period – just walk in and walk out with guns and magazines. Pay $500 in Indiana, cross the border, and sell for a thousand.

Twenty-Four Million

02 Sunday Apr 2023

Posted by Commentary about the Blue Marble in Gun Control

≈ Leave a comment

    In the run-up to the midterm elections, the National Rifle Association spent sixteen million on 257 Republican nominees plus another 8 million on lobbying state and federal Legislatures. How many millions were spent on influencers and propaganda on social media? Most of the twenty-four million came from their members who believe the line they are fed. Most of the rest is from the gun manufacturers and retailers.

      The manufacturers and retailers have been successful in their efforts to persuade legislators to pass laws protecting them from lawsuits involving bad manufacturing and usage by murderers. They have done this with campaign donations and direct money in the legislators pockets through legal ways.

Twenty Millimeter Chain Gun

11 Saturday Feb 2023

Posted by Commentary about the Blue Marble in Gun Control

≈ Leave a comment

        The Second Amendment was approved before revolvers were invented much less bolt action and lever action rifles in the 1800s. The Thompson (Tommy) Sub-machine gun came along in 1918 and in June 1922, Congress passed the Firearms Act prohibiting them. In 1986 the Firearms Owners Protection Act banned automatic weapons with the NRA Support which was before they changed leadership and manufacturers started supporting them financially.

            Today an owner of an AR-15 type weapon can quickly and easily be converted to an automatic by an on-line purchase of a couple of parts. The instructions accompanying the parts are so easy Junior High kids could probably do it. Anyone can order the parts.
